In this episode of Committed, we sit down with Jordyn Glick and Dakota Heath to explore their journey through love, resilience, and the challenges of young adult caregiving. Jordyn was diagnosed with gastroparesis, a chronic condition that affects stomach function and significantly impacts her daily life. Her partner, Dakota, stepped into the role of primary caregiver, navigating the emotional and logistical complexities that come with supporting a loved one through illness. Together, they share their candid experiences of balancing their relationship with the demands of Jordyn’s health, the sacrifices they've made, and the unwavering commitment that has strengthened their bond. This episode delves into the realities of caregiving at a young age, offering an inspiring perspective on love, perseverance, and the power of partnership.

In their first appearance on Committed, Mike and Nicole Conforto opened up about how Mike’s severe OCD turned their lives upside down. His obsessive fears for his infant son's safety spiraled into debilitating panic attacks and constant anxiety, straining their marriage and making parenthood an overwhelming challenge. The episode delved into Mike's diagnosis, their struggles as a family, and the long road toward managing his condition.In this follow-up, Mike and Nicole share how life has changed since their initial conversation. They discuss the progress Mike has made in therapy, how they continue to navigate the ups and downs of OCD as a couple, and the lessons they’ve learned about resilience and support. This candid update offers a deeper look into their ongoing journey, providing hope and insight for families facing similar challenges.
